    Check for air getting into the fuel injection system. Does your engine still have a fuel priming pump?. If it does, maybe you can manually prime your injection pump and remove the air from the injectors.

    Can also be due to dirty fuel filter.

    Check if solenoid cable have power supply when you start. Also check for continuity of the solenoid coil. if you can connect it directly to the battery then start. when you connect it directly and you hear a click then the solenoid is ok.
